HARRISBURG –- Central Dauphin freshman Trey Salvaggio had a varsity debut to remember Thursday night as he faced State College junior Jon Whitbred in a 133-pound dual meet bout.

Salvaggio trailed Whitbred by two points in the waning seconds but managed to parlay a headlock into a three-point takedown just before the buzzer to score an emphatic 6-5 victory.

The bout helped propel the Central Dauphin boys wrestlers to a 46-18 victory over State College in the Mid-Penn Conference Commonwealth Division season-opener for both squads.
